Actor Anupam Kher reacted to boycott trends against Pathaan and said nothing can sabotage a good film. He also said that 'film audience' never boycotted cinema.

Actor Anupam Kher recently opened up about the failure of boycott trends against Shah Rukh Khan's Pathaan as the film continue to rule the box office. Directed by Siddharth Anand, the film made a business of 832.2 crore worldwide in just 12 days. Talking about the film, Anupam said people have watched it even in vengeance. Pathaan landed in a controversy after the release of the film's first song Besharam Rang last year. It received criticism from many due to Deepika's outfits, including her saffron bikini. Some people found the song objectionable and protested against it for allegedly hurting their religious sentiments. The film also faced a boycott trend on social media.

Talking about how Pathaan touched success beyond all expectations, Anupam was quoted by DNA saying, “Aap trend dekh ke thodi picture dekhne jaoge. Koi bhi nahi jaata trend padh ke. Agar aapko trailer aacha laga toh aap jayege film dekhne. Jab pitcute aachi hai toh duniya ki koi takat nahi rok sakti. Log toh vengeance se jaate hai ki 'mujhe toh dekhni hai film' (No one gets influenced to watch a film by a trend. If you liked the trailer of the film, you want to watch it. If the film is well-made, no one has the power to sabotage it. People even go for the film with a feeling of vengeance against the hate trend).”

“The film audience never boycotted cinema. We had gone through the Covid pandemic, there was a lockdown, and people were asked to sit in their houses. This has happened after 100 years or so. During this phase, audiences look out for other means of entertainment. The OTT platforms saw a boost, and they started watching the films with their ease. To bring them (audiences) out of fear takes some time,” he added.

Anupam will be next seen in the film Shiv Shastri Balboa. It also features Neena Gupta, Nargis Fakhri, and Sharib Hashmi in important roles. Directed by Ajay Venugopalan, it is backed by Kishore Varieth. It will hit the theatres on February 10.
